Road closures stepped up again in Weston Hills for recovery work of crashed F-15 jet

Road closures around Weston Hills will be tightened again to allow recovery of the crashed F-15 military jet plane.

Over the next two days there will be heavy plant machinery in the village. Much of it will be approaching from the north end of the village and residents are asked for their patience at this time.

Access along Broadgate will be severely restricted between the junction with Moulton Chapel Road and Fengate Drove.

Insp Jim Tyner said: “For the past few days, we have been able to relax the road closure for residents but for the next couple of days there will be no access through the cordon. This is necessary for safety reasons.”

Insp Tyner said that it is hoped the recovery phase will be complete and the roads fully open by Saturday.
